Downpipes Maintenance: A Comprehensive Guide
Downpipes play a crucial role in the appropriate drainage system of structures, helping prevent water damage to structures, roofs, and other crucial areas. Like any other part of your home's infrastructure, downpipes need routine maintenance to run successfully. This article will provide a comprehensive analysis of downpipe maintenance, its significance, indications of problems, common problems, and comprehensive maintenance suggestions.
Why is Downpipe Maintenance Important?
Downpipes assistance channel rainwater from the Roof Fascias to the drain system, directing it far from the structure's structure. Disregarding Fascias Maintenance can lead to a series of issues, including:

How Often Should I Clean My Downpipes?
Response: At minimum, downpipes should be examined and cleaned at least twice a year, preferably in spring and fall. If you live in an area with many trees, think about increasing this frequency.
2. What Tools Do I Need for Downpipe Maintenance?
Answer: Basic tools include a ladder, gloves, a garden hose pipe, a plumbing technician's snake, and a downpipe guard for defense against particles.
3. Can I Repair Downpipes Myself?
Response: Yes, you can carry out minor repair work such as sealing little cracks or cleaning up blockages. However, for significant replacements or if you're uncertain, employing an expert is advised.
